I ntroduction. There seems to be some considerabk reason for believing that the hero of this story was a reality. The story tells us that he lived in the marsh of the I sle of Ely, and that he became a brewers man at Lyn, and traded toW isbeach. This little piece of geographical evidence enables us to fix the story as belonging to the great Fen District, which occupied the north of Cambridgeshire and Norfolk. The antiquary Thomas Hearne has gone so far as to identify the hero uf tradition with a doughty knight of the Crusaders. Writing in theS tuartrly Rtuieiv (vol, xxi. p. loa). Sir Francis Palgrave says :M r. Thomas Hickathrift, afterwards Sir Thomas Hickathrift. Knight, is praised by Mr. Thomas Hearne as a fimious champion. The honest antiquary has identified this wellknown knight with the fiir less celebrated Sir Frederick de Tylney, Baron ofT ylney inN orfolk, the ancestor of the Tylney fimiily who was killed at A eon, inS yria, in the reign of Richard Cceur de Lion. I ntroduction. This chap-book is not a story. It is a collection of charms and dreams supposed to have been communicated by a personage bearing the name of Mother Bunch, a name unhistorical and, so far as I have been able to ascertain, unknown to any other department of literature. The edition here printed is made up of two distinct parts. The first part is the oldest, and at one time the only portion extt. This is reprinted from the copy in the Pepsyian Library at Cambridge, dated 1685. The second part is printed from the copy in theB ritish Museum library, and dated by the authorities there 1780, this being the earliest version I have been able to find. ,F rom the wording of its title, fM other Bunch sC loset Newly Broke Open there is evidence of the first part being a continuatipn of a chap-book already issued upon the same subject. GOMME, George Laurence was born in 1853 in London.
Studied at City of London School.
Formerly edited the Antiquary, the Archaeological Review, and the Folklore Journal. Lecturer at the London School of Economics and University Extension. Fellow.of the Royal Statistical Society.
Fellow of the Anthropological Institute. Formerly President and now Vice-President of the Folklore Society. Honourable Member of the Glasgow Archaeological Society.
Author; fonnerly Statistical Officer and now Clerk to the London County Council. Original founder and some time secretary of the Folklore Society.
